Delightful Baked Buns

  • Total Time: 120 minutes
  • Yield: 12 servings
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

Soft, fragrant buns infused with spices and sweet currants, perfect for festive gatherings or a cozy morning treat.


Ingredients

  • 4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 packet (2 ¼ tsp) yeast
  • ½ cup granulated sugar
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 2 teaspoons mixed spice (e.g., cinnamon, nutmeg)
  • ½ cup milk, warmed
  • ½ c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 cup dried fruit (currants or raisins)
  • 1 egg (for egg wash)


Instructions

  1. Mix together the warm milk, yeast, and sugar. Let it sit until frothy.
  2. Combine the flour, salt, and mixed spice in another bowl. Gradually add this dry mixture to the yeast mixture.
  3. Pour in the melted butter and add eggs, mixing until a soft dough forms.
  4. Knead the dough on a floured surface for about 10 minutes until it’s smooth.
  5. Incorporate the dried fruit into your dough, then place it in a greased bowl. Cover it with a towel and let it rise until doubled in size, about an hour.
  6. Once risen, punch down the dough and shape it into 12 equal portions. Place them in a greased baking pan and let them rise again for 30 minutes.
  7.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Brush the tops with an egg wash.
  8. Bake for 20-25 minutes or until golden brown. Cool before serving.

Notes

For enhanced flavor, consider adding a touch of orange or lemon zest to the dough. Kneading is key for a soft texture.
